About Jörg Maletz
Jörg Maletz is a scholar working on Paleontology, Atmospheric Science, Oceanography, Geology and Ecology, Evolution, Behavior and Systematics, having authored 192 papers that have together received 2.4k indexed citations. Recurring topics across this work include Paleontology and Stratigraphy of Fossils (129 papers), Geology and Paleoclimatology Research (68 papers), Paleontology and Evolutionary Biology (33 papers), Evolution and Paleontology Studies (30 papers), Marine Biology and Ecology Research (23 papers), Geological Studies and Exploration (21 papers), Geological and Geochemical Analysis (15 papers) and Ichthyology and Marine Biology (15 papers). The work is most often cited by research in Paleontology (2.0k citations), Geology (341 citations), Atmospheric Science (978 citations), Oceanography (490 citations) and Earth-Surface Processes (246 citations). Jörg Maletz has collaborated with scholars based in Germany, United States and China. Frequent co-authors include Sven Egenhoff, Charles E. Mitchell, Per Ahlberg, David L. Bruton, Stig M. Bergström, Michael Steiner, Anita Löfgren, David K. Loydell, Blanca A. Toro and Michael J. Melchin. Their work appears in journals such as Paläontologische Zeitschrift, GFF, Palaeontology, Canadian Journal of Earth Sciences and Lethaia.
